Extended Data Fig. 7: Phylogenetic analysis based on the available amino acid sequences of RLP39-RLP42 from 23 A. thaliana accessions.

From: Distinct immune sensor systems for fungal endopolygalacturonases in closely related Brassicaceae

Extended Data Fig. 7

The evolutionary history was inferred using the Neighbour-Joining method. The optimal tree with the sum of branch length = 0.54412429 is shown. The tree is drawn to scale, with branch lengths in the same units as those of the evolutionary distances used to infer the phylogenetic tree. The evolutionary distances were computed using the Poisson correction method and the evolutionary analyses were conducted in MEGA X. Pg13(At)-sensitive and pg13(At)-insensitive accessions are indicated as + and -, respectively. *, “Z”s [RLP42 (Ct-1)] indicate unknown amino acids.
